Co-Founder, ShareholderUrb-E, Egological Mobility Solutions Inc. Dec 2013 - 2015URB-E is the world's most compact e-vehicle that is small enough to fit in between your legs while sitting on a train, bus or car. Our team are passionate designers, entrepreneurs, engineers and believe disruptive solutions can be sustainable and can scale to the masses. URB-E was developed out of Ideapiphany LLC through their new urban mobility venture called Egological Mobility Solutions. Personal needs and experience in researching the problems of urban planning and transportation worldwide fueled the fire to launch a solution for the first and last mile problem.With 70% of world’s population living in urban cities in 2025, commuters will need more useful options for 1st & last mile problem and today that need is already growing. Current products are expensive, bulky and not easy to use, so we developed Urb-e in January 2013 and built many iterations of prototypes, testing with consumers and constantly refining to be better and solve the problem. Design Manager/Experience DesignFord Motor Company 1999 - 2001Dearborn, Michigan, UsDesign Manager / Brand Experience: Brand Image Strategist and Experience Designer for the company’s portfolio of brands including: Aston Martin, Jaguar, Land Rover, Volvo, Lincoln, Mercury, Ford and Mazda. • Conducted research to define and delineate the portfolio of brands through consumer insight by studying the perception of color, texture, material and form through brand filters.• Developed visual design strategy, design direction of brand implementation for transportation design, retail design, events, media and product design brand extensions. • Developed brand alignment immersion events for “C” level and VP level stakeholders between design, manufacturing, engineering and marketing.• Researched, designed and developed Ford Japan’s and Ford China’s branded experience. -
